I was a little skeptical ordering clippings online. I had purchased seedlings before but not like this. Since I have taken my own cuttings before I took the chance. So glad I did. The Folks over at CZ Grain know their business. I ordered 3 plant cuttings. Dragon Willow, Golden curl willow and money tree. I placed the order all on March 21st with an estimated delivery date on April 1st. Cuttings came in early on March 25th. All cuttings came in good shape and the ends wrapped in damp paper towel. I removed from the package and placed them in canning jars with a few inches of water. I kept them inside as it still chilly here. Today, April 10th they were all ready for planting. Roots were minimum 2 inches long. They also had leaf stem growth. I’m only sorry I didn’t get pictures along the way. Highly recommend CZ Grain and their trees.

I bought these around 6 months ago. They looked pretty beat up when they arrived but the 3 stalks rooted easily in water. After 2-3 weeks I planted 2 in high quality bonsai soil and one in a compost blend.The one planted in compost died almost immediately. I have other plants thriving in the soil so not sure what happened.Of the two planted in the bonsai soil, one died after a few more months. The last one is still hanging on, but no new growth beyond the two spindly shoots that grew shortly after it was potted.Unclear what was wrong. Can't really blame the product I guess since they rooted easily.
